Prediction of Fluid Pressure Dynamics in Deflagration Fracturing for Unconventional Reservoir Stimulation Based on Physics-Guided Graph Neural Network

open access: yesEnergies
Deflagration fracturing is a gas-dominated, water-free reservoir stimulation technology that has shown strong potential in unconventional, low-permeability, or water-sensitive reservoirs such as coalbed methane and shale gas formations.
